The roots of modern automation date back several decades. Early automation efforts involved numerical control (NC) machines and programmable logic controllers (PLCs), which allowed repetitive production tasks to be carried out with improved precision. One pioneer in this domain, FANUC, emerged from early numerical-control development and eventually captured a substantial share of the global CNC (computer numerical control) market. Over time, the concept expanded beyond fixed automation, as advances in electronics, computing, robotics, and sensing opened the possibility for more flexible, intelligent, and networked industrial systems.

The Project Engineering and Installation segment is leading the Global Industrial Automation Services Market by Service Type in 2024, growing at a CAGR of 9 % during the forecast period. The project engineering and installation segment in the industrial automation services market is defined by its role in designing, integrating, and deploying automation frameworks within industrial facilities, ensuring smooth transition from manual or semi-automated systems to fully automated operational environments.

The Manufacturing segment led the Global Industrial Automation Services Market by End-use in 2024, and would continue to be a dominant market till 2032; thereby, achieving a market value of $76.55 billion by 2032. The manufacturing segment represents a major operational field for industrial automation services, driven by the increasing shift toward automated production lines, machine integration, and digitally managed workflows that enhance product consistency and productivity.

The DCS segment is generating maximum revenue share in dominated the Global Industrial Automation Services Market by Product Type in 2024, growing at a CAGR of 8.9 % during the forecast period. The DCS (distributed control system) segment in the industrial automation services market is characterized by its strong integration capability across complex industrial environments, enabling centralized monitoring, management, and coordination of multiple processes within large facilities. This product type is widely utilized for continuous production applications where precise control, operational reliability, and system scalability are critical to performance optimization.
